1. Sandy Pines Campground
Sandy Pines is the perfect Maine campground that is the ideal mix of camping with a little high-end. With a deep sea swimming pool, family-oriented tasks, and large grounds, this is the area to opt for a weekend break escape or make it your seasonal camping area.

The camping site supplies traditional recreational vehicle and outdoor tents websites in addition to glamping areas like teepees, Airstream trailers (Breeze or Wayfarer), Chuck Wagon, and Conestoga wagons. Every one of these glamping rooms come with genuine beds and electrical energy, unusual decor, heated floors, outside eating locations, and a lot of room.

Located in the quaint seaside town of Kennebunkport, this camping area has a classic ambiance that will instantly transfer you to an easier time. It's likewise within a brief drive of Goose Rocks Coastline, which is one of the most lovely coastlines in Maine.

2. Savage River Lodge
Taking a trip west along I-68 in northwestern Maryland is a scenic experience. The highway crosses the engineering marvel referred to as Sideling Hillside, and passes by charming major roads and home town restaurants.

Concealed in the middle of Savage River State Forest, the lodge's 18 cabins were handcrafted from white pine and feature authentic chinking. The cabins are a good option for romantic trips, distinct household holidays and rustic team trips.

In 2014, the facility broadened its offerings with 8 glamping yurts. The unique lodgings were created and constructed by Pacific Yurts. They supply king-sized beds, glowing flooring home heating and domed skylights. The yurts do not enable family pets, which may make them a better option for travelers with allergies. 3. Governors Island
Glampers can enjoy the island's relaxing setting with a selection of exterior tasks. The extensive bucolic space, which was once an armed forces base, has turned into a city play area and cultural destination.

It's a quick and affordable ferryboat adventure from Manhattan or Brooklyn, with boats departing the Battery Maritime Structure in Lower Manhattan and Brooklyn Bridge Park on the weekends. The 172-acre island is car-free, features parks and restaurants, art installations, historic monoliths, and first-rate views.

Visitors can spend the day exploring Castle William and Ft Jay, and glampers can take pleasure in the sunset from their outdoor tents, which has breathtaking home windows. Afterward, guests can loosen up in their king-size bed with its plush duvet and 1500-thread matter sheets. Then, they can wake up to a sight of the Sculpture of Liberty.
